Iron Tracks

Iron Tracks is a deck tracker for the Pokemon Trading Card Game Live, whose goal is to allow players to easily keep track of their deck resources in-game with live UI. Iron Tracks is a Unity Mod using MelonLoader API to load the modules into the game. Installation

  1. Navigate to the Releases Page.

    image

  2. Download the latest verison zip in the Release Page.

    image

  3. Open up IronTracks.zip (Note that inside the zip you should see a IronTracks folder) extract all the contents of IronTracks folder (not to be confused with the .zip) into your PTCGL's client's folder.

    image

  4. Press Z/X in-game to toggle the Deck Tracker UI!

Controls

  • Press Z to enable the Deck Tracker
  • Press X to enable the Prize Tracker

Developer Notes/FAQ

  • Q: My MelonLoader isn't loading your mod correctly, how do I fix this?
    • A: The only valid Melon Loader version for the current PTCGL is v0.5.7
  • Q: I'm getting error Failed to Open Mono Assembly:

image

  • A: This error is caused by the MelonLoader program being unable to read the é in the word "Pokémon". This can be fixed by changing your PTCGL client's folder to something else I.E. PTCGL

[BUG] Playing Heavy Ball as first card during game de-sync

Describe the bug
When using a heavy ball as the first deck search of the game, the deck tracker desyncs and no longer accurate keeps tracks of cards that are in your deck.

Expected behavior
The deck tracker should automatically subtract the cards that are revealed from the prize cards to keep in-sync.
